BoC: Deputy Governor Sylvain Leduc to leave the Bank in late July

The Bank of Canada has just recently announced that Deputy Governor Sylvain Leduc will leave the Bank in late July 2018.

"Mr. Leduc will return to San Francisco with his family to resume working at the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co," the Bank said.

Governor Stephen S. Poloz stated the following.

"Sylvain has been a wonderful addition to Governing Council. We have benefitted from his policy expertise and his strong sense of teamwork. Sylvain’s motivation and leadership has had a powerful impact on our researchers and on the Bank’s capacity as a research institution. While we are sorry to say good-bye to this brilliant Canadian, we wish him every success in his future career in central banking.”
